To optimize the hydrolysis conditions to prepare hydrolysates of jellyfish umbrella collagen with the highest hydroxyl radical scavenging activity, collagen extracted from jellyfish umbrella was hydrolyzed with trypsin, and response surface methodology (RSM) was applied. The optimum conditions obtained from experiments were pH 7.75, temperature (7) 48.77 ℃, and enzyme-to-substrate ratio ([E]/[S]) 3.50%. The analysis of variance in RSM showed that pH and [E]/[S] were important factors that significantly affected the process (P<0.05 and P<0.01, respectively). 胶原—磷酸钙复合物是最重要的人工骨框架材料。植入体内的材料结构对材料的生物降解、诱导新骨的生长具有重要的影响.通过透射电镜、扫描电镜、能谱分析等方法,研究了胶原—磷酸钙复合物结构随时间的变化关系,分析了复合物在静止状态和搅拌状态下结构变化的成因. 相似文献

川芎嗪对糖尿病大鼠骨质疏松的保护作用 总被引:2,自引:0,他引:2
探讨川芎嗪对糖尿病大鼠骨质疏松的保护作用.选择健康SD大鼠,随机分为正常对照组、糖尿病(DM)模型组和治疗组.一次性腹腔注射链脲佐菌素60mg/kg诱发糖尿病.HE染色观察股骨头结构变化;VanGieson氏染色法观察骨胶原纤维;紫外分光光度法测定醛糖还原酶(AR)、骨羟脯氨酸(B-HYP)和甲状旁腺激素(PTH)的含量.结果,DM模型组大鼠AR和PTH含量显著增高(P<0.01).B-HYP含量显著降低(P<0.01).胶原纤维减少,川芎嗪可逆转上述改变(P<0.01).结果表明,川芎嗪对糖尿病大鼠骨质疏松有一定的治疗作用. 相似文献

Adjuvant induced arthritis (AIA) is a model widely used to study Rheumatoid arthritis (RA). In the present study, lipid peroxides
level in spleen and thymus of AIA rats was observed to be significantly high compared to normal rats. A significant decrease
in ascorbic acid (ASA), reduced glutathione (GSH), superoxide dismutase activity (SOD) was also observed in spleen and thymus
of AIA rats compared to normal rats. There was also a steady increase in the circulating immune complex level (CIC) throughout
the experimental period in serum of AIA rats. In the present investigation, it was decided to study the effect of pre and
post treatment with TYPE II collagen on the antioxidant status and the circulating immune complex level in AIA rats. The results
from the present work indicates that the pretreatment with TYPE II collagen was effective in bringing significant changes
on all the parameters studied in AIA rats. The post treatment with TYPE II collagen was effective in bringing significant
changes on the CIC immune complex level and GSH content in the thymus tissue of AIA rats. The present work suggests that the
pre treatment with TYPE II collagen was more effective in suppressing the disease than the post treatment. 相似文献
